Key Features

  • Auto-zoom on clicks — Screen Studio automatically zooms into your cursor when you click, making key actions easy to follow without manual editing.
  • Smooth cursor animations — Cursor movements are automatically smoothed, so your recordings look steady and professional even if your mouse movement isn't.
  • Background and padding controls — Add custom backgrounds, padding, and rounded corners to your recording window for a clean, modern look.
  • Fast export — Videos export quickly in high quality, ready to share or upload without extra post-processing steps.
  • App and window recording — Record a specific app window, your full screen, or a custom region with a straightforward selection tool.
  • Aspect ratio presets — Switch between aspect ratios like 16:9, 1:1, and 9:16 to fit social media, YouTube, or presentation formats easily.

Screen Studio Review: Alternative Apps

Loom

Loom is a screen recorder focused on quick sharing and team communication. It includes a built-in link-sharing system, making it a good fit for async team workflows. It doesn't offer the same cinematic zoom and animation effects that Screen Studio provides.

CleanShot X

CleanShot X is a powerful Mac screenshot and screen recording tool. It handles screenshots, scrolling captures, and video recording well. It doesn't focus on the automated cinematic effects like auto-zoom that Screen Studio is known for.

Cursorful

Cursorful is a Screen Studio alternative that also offers automatic zooms and pans based on mouse clicks. It's aimed at creators who want polished recordings with minimal manual editing. Worth comparing directly if you're evaluating tools in this category.

Cap

Cap is a screen recording tool with offline editing capabilities. It's a straightforward option for creators who want local recording without relying on cloud-based workflows. A practical alternative if simplicity and offline access are priorities.

Rotato

Rotato is a Mac app focused on creating 3D app mockup videos and device previews. It's more for marketing visuals than real-time screen recording. Useful alongside Screen Studio if you need polished product mockup videos as well.

Pros and Cons

Advantages

  • Auto-zoom saves editing time — Automatic click zoom means you skip a lot of manual keyframing work in post-production.
  • Looks professional instantly — Recordings look polished right away without needing a separate video editor.
  • Native Mac app — Designed specifically for macOS, so it runs smoothly and feels like it belongs on your system.

Disadvantages

  • Mac only — Screen Studio does not work on Windows or Linux, so it's not an option for cross-platform teams.
  • No free plan — A paid license is required for full, ongoing access.
  • Limited advanced editing — Screen Studio is not a full video editor, so complex edits still require a separate tool.

Does Screen Studio sync across devices?

Screen Studio is a Mac-only app. It does not sync across devices or platforms. Your recordings are stored locally on your Mac.

Can I use Screen Studio offline?

Yes, Screen Studio works offline. It's a native Mac app and does not require an internet connection to record or export your videos.
